Output f346c623ded77a88b938d661941ce1b9dff92b2320f2c649a947cbc14edca574:25

value
313284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 909136680bf1b368c5a045b4e88258d60b99442c OP_EQUALVERIFY OP_CHECKSIG
address
1EBQGAfogdgHRs3kBnR2fAwtNGNiQAEGu8
transaction
f346c623ded77a88b938d661941ce1b9dff92b2320f2c649a947cbc14edca574
confirmations
217590
spent
true